Frequently Asked Questions About Water Heater Repair in Nances Creek, AL

The dedicated water shut-off valve is located on the cold water inlet pipe entering the top of your water heater. It is usually a red or blue ball valve lever or a round gate valve wheel.
A sulfur odor is usually caused by anaerobic bacteria in your water supply reacting with the tank's magnesium sacrificial anode rod. Our technicians in Nances Creek, AL can sanitize the tank and install an aluminum-zinc or powered titanium anode rod to neutralize the smell permanently.
The anode rod is a magnesium or aluminum core inside the tank that attracts corrosive minerals, sacrificing itself to prevent the steel tank from rusting. It should be inspected every 2 to 3 years and replaced when more than 50% depleted.

If your water heater is under 10 years old and the problem involves a replaceable component—such as a heating element, thermostat, thermocouple, or relief valve—repair is usually cost-effective. However, if the internal tank has rusted through and is leaking from the base, replacement is necessary.
